1. Is the relation a function? Why or why not?<br> {(-3,-2),(-1,0), (1, 0), (5,-2)}
34kurt

Answer:

yes, the given relation is a function.

Step-by-step explanation:

The given relation is

{(–3, –2), (–1, 0), (1, 0), (5, –2)}

A relation is called function if each element of the domain is paired with exactly one element of the range.

It means for each value of x there exist a unique value of y.

In the given relation for each value of x there exist a unique value of y.

Therefore the required solution is yes and this relation is a function.

9x - 3y = -42 and -9x + 8y =22
ASHA 777 [7]

Answer:

(-5 1/9, -4)

Step-by-step explanation:

Add the equations

5y=-20

y=-4

-9x+8(-4)=22

-9x-32=22

-9x=46

x= - 5 1/9
